2024IMARC Group全球负压伤口治疗市场规模达到 29.128 亿美元。推动市场成长的关键因素包括慢性伤口和糖尿病在人群中的发病率不断上升、医疗服务提供者对 NPWT 治疗慢性和复杂伤口的疗效的认识不断提高以及技术的持续进步。

负压伤口治疗(NPWT)是一种用于增强伤口癒合过程的医疗治疗方法。它涉及应用真空泵、泡沫敷料和粘合膜来吸出液体并促进组织生长。此技术是治疗各种类型伤口(包括手术切口、压疮和糖尿病伤口)的有效选择。透过在伤口周围创造一个封闭的吸力环境,NPWT 有助于减少细菌、保持湿润环境并将伤口边缘拉近。这些条件有利于更快地癒合并降低感染风险。真空帮浦通常是便携式的,使患者能够以最少的不便继续日常活动。此外,它已成为伤口护理管理的标准方法,提供了更有效的方法来促进癒合、减少併发症并改善患者的生活品质。

The global negative pressure wound therapy market size reached USD 2,912.8 Million in 2024. Looking forward, IMARC Group expects the market to reach USD 4,214.7 Million by 2033, exhibiting a growth rate (CAGR) of 4.2% during 2025-2033. The rising prevalence of chronic wounds and diabetes among the masses, the growing awareness among healthcare providers about the efficacy of NPWT in treating chronic and complicated wounds, and continuous technological advancements are among the key factors driving the market growth.

Negative pressure wound therapy (NPWT) is a medical treatment used to enhance the healing process of wounds. It involves the application of a vacuum pump, a foam dressing, and an adhesive film to draw out fluid and promote tissue growth. This technology serves as an effective option for treating various types of wounds including surgical incisions, pressure ulcers, and diabetic wounds. By creating a closed, suction environment around the wound, NPWT aids in reducing bacteria, maintaining a moist setting, and drawing wound edges together. These conditions are conducive to faster healing and reduced infection risk. The vacuum pump is usually portable, allowing patients to continue daily activities with minimal inconvenience. Furthermore, it has become a standard approach in wound care management, offering a more efficient way to promote healing, reduce complications, and improve patients' quality of life.

Surgical and traumatic wounds hold the largest market share

The demand for effective treatments for surgical and traumatic wounds is a notable market driver in the negative pressure wound therapy (NPWT) industry. Surgical wounds are an inevitable consequence of medical procedures, and their proper management is crucial to minimize post-operative complications, such as infections or dehiscence. Similarly, traumatic wounds resulting from accidents, burns, or other injuries require prompt and effective care to optimize healing and prevent complications. NPWT is increasingly being recognized as a reliable method for accelerating the healing of these wounds, as it helps to remove excess fluid, reduce bacterial load, and promote tissue regeneration. The therapy is particularly beneficial in complex surgical cases and severe trauma wounds, where rapid wound closure is crucial for patient recovery. As the number of surgical procedures and incidence of traumatic injuries continue to rise globally, the need for advanced wound care solutions mainly NPWT is growing. This growing demand underscores the importance of NPWT in the treatment of surgical and traumatic wounds, thereby driving market growth.
